Most Popular Books

Archives

Agile Modellierung mit UML: Codegenerierung, Testfälle, - download pdf or read online

By Bernhard Rumpe

ISBN-10: 3642224296

ISBN-13: 9783642224294

ISBN-10: 364222430X

ISBN-13: 9783642224300

Im wachsenden Portfolio von Entwicklungstechniken zeichnen sich zwei wichtige traits ab. Zum einen dominiert die UML als Modellierungssprache. Zum anderen werden agile Methoden in mittlerweile sehr vielen Softwareentwicklungen eingesetzt. Dieses Buch stellt Konzepte einer Entwicklungsmethodik vor, die UML mit Elementen agiler Methoden kombiniert. Dabei werden ausgehend von den Klassen-, Objekt-, Sequenzdiagrammen, Statecharts und der OCL die Umsetzung nach Java und dem Testframework JUnit diskutiert, sowie Techniken zur Entwicklung von Testfällen und der evolutionären Weiterentwicklung von Entwürfen mit Refactoring-Regeln vorgestellt. Der im Buch beschriebene Ansatz eignet sich besonders für den Einsatz in Anwendungsdomänen, in denen hohe Qualität, Flexibilität und Erweiterbarkeit der Systeme erwartet wird, und sich Anforderungen dynamisch und noch während der Erstellung des Produkts weiterentwickeln. Diese Methodik ist geeignet für Praktiker, die Modellierungstechniken professionell nutzen wollen. Unter http://www.se-rwth.de/mbse ist weiterführendes fabric zu finden.

Die zweite Auflage ist durchgehend überarbeitet und basiert auf UML 2.3 und der Java-Version 6.

Show description

Read Online or Download Agile Modellierung mit UML: Codegenerierung, Testfälle, Refactoring PDF

Best german_14 books

New PDF release: Bilanzen und Bilanztheorien

Die nachfolgenden Ausfuhrungen haben sich zum Ziel gesetzt, den Leser in die Bilanzfragen einzufuhren. In der in diesem Werke enthaltenen Abhandlung uber Buchhaltung von Prof. Kal veram ist bereits der Zusammenhang der Bilanz mit der Buch haltung gezeigt. Hier kommt es vor allem darauf an, die ver schiedenen Arten der Bilanz sowie der Gewinn- und Verlust rechnung, ferner ihre Gliederung zu zeigen und gleichzeitig in die wichtigsten formalen und materiellen Probleme des Bilanz wesens einzufuhren.

Download PDF by Franz R. Nick: Arbeitsmethodik und Rhetorik

Wir alle kennen den Mitarbeiter im Betrieb, der hinter einem übervollen Schreibtisch sitzt, den ganzen Tag über fleißig arbeitet und dennoch am Abend feststellt, daß er trotz aller Mühe keine besondere Leistung erbracht hat. Ein anderer Mitarbeiter hingegen bewältigt dieselben Aufgaben in angemesse­ ner Weise, sein Arbeitsplatz ist übersichtlich und aufgeräumt, er findet sogar noch die Zeit, sich mit seinen Kollegen zu besprechen und ihnen mit Ratschlägen zu helfen.

Read e-book online Einführung in die Statistik mit EXCEL und SPSS: Ein PDF

Die Autorin führt in die beschreibende und schließende Statistik sowie in die Wahrscheinlichkeitsrechnung ein. Die Methoden werden nicht nur beschrieben, sondern anhand zahlreicher Beispiele in EXCEL und SPSS umgesetzt. Auch für das Selbststudium geeignet.

Ourania Menelaou's Weiterbildung im Gebiet Innere Medizin PDF

Diese Buch ist eine wirkliche Fundgrube über das gesamte Spektrum der Weiterbildung in der Inneren Medizin. Es soll eine wichtige Orientierungshilfe darstellen nicht nur für den jungen Arzt, der sich am Anfang der Weiterbildung befindet, sondern es richtet sich auch an den schon in der Weiterbildung befindlichen Arzt, der verschiedene berufliche Perspektiven im Auge hat.

Additional info for Agile Modellierung mit UML: Codegenerierung, Testfälle, Refactoring

Example text

Vererbung und Interface-Implementierung beschreibt einen Ausschnitt aus dem Auktionssystem mit mehreren Assoziationen in unterschiedlichen Formen. Eine Assoziation besitzt im Normalfall einen Assoziationsnamen und fur ¨ jedes der beiden Enden je eine Assoziationsrolle, eine Angabe der Kardinalit¨at und eine Beschreibung der moglichen ¨ Navigationsrichtungen. Einzelne Angaben konnen ¨ im Modell auch weggelassen werden, wenn sie zur Darstellung des gewunschten ¨ Sachverhalts keine Rolle spielen und die Eindeutigkeit nicht verloren geht.

W¨ahrend in explizit qualifizierten Assoziationen die Art des Qualifikators w¨ahlbar ist, stehen in geordneten Assoziationen ganzzahlige Intervalle beginnend mit der 0 zur Verfugung. 7. 3 Repr¨asentation und Stereotypen Klassendiagramme haben oft das Ziel, die fur ¨ eine bestimmte Aufgabe notwendige Datenstruktur einschließlich ihrer Zusammenh¨ange zu beschrei¨ ben. Eine vollst¨andige Liste aller Methoden und Attribute ist fur ¨ einen Uberblick dabei eher hinderlich. Ein Klassendiagramm stellt daher meist eine unvollst¨andige Sicht des Gesamtsystems dar.

Dazu gehoren ¨ zum Beispiel Mutationstests [Voa95, KCM00, Moo01], die durch einfache Mutation des Testlings prufen, ¨ ob diese Ver¨anderungen durch einen Test entdeckt werden. Ist die Implementierung der gewunschten ¨ Funktionalit¨at gegeben, so sollte nach Erfullung ¨ der initialen Testsammlung durch die Entwicklung ¨ weiterer Tests eine bessere Uberdeckung erreicht werden. Dazu gehoren ¨ zum Beispiel die Behandlung von Grenzwertf¨allen und die Untersuchung von Fallunterscheidungen und Schleifen, die teilweise durch die Technik oder ein genutztes Framework bedingt sein konnen ¨ und deshalb in den vorab entwickelten Testf¨allen nicht antizipiert wurden.

Download PDF sample

Agile Modellierung mit UML: Codegenerierung, Testfälle, Refactoring by Bernhard Rumpe


by Kevin
4.5

Rated 4.03 of 5 – based on 40 votes

Comments are closed.